APC, PDP'S Mind Game in Kwara

Date: 2014-03-25

INDICATIONS that next year’s general election in Kwara State will be quite interesting have started to emerge judging from recent political developments in and around the state. One factor that will make it interesting is the fact that the elections will be contested in reality between only two political parties, among the many political parties in the state. Only the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) and the ruling All Progressives Congress (APC) are visibly present in the state and holding political activities as well as also being recognised by the police command the invitation and presence of the parties’ leadership at a recent stakeholders meeting called by the state police command ahead of the 2015 polls is considered.

The ruling APC gears up to consolidate its dominance on the political landscape in the state, with its control of 16 local government council areas, 22; out of 24 members of the state House of Assembly; all members of the House of Representatives in the state and all but one senator from the state, PDP, which is now the opposition party, says it is set to cause an upset in the power configuration in the state. Indeed, when a delegation of PDP leaders from the state, led by Hajia Bola Shagaya, paid a thank you visit to President Goodluck Jonathan in Abuja recently, following his attendance in Ilorin to attend a political rally. The President vowed that PDP would win all elected positions that had been seized by the Senator Bukola Saraki-led APC in the state, saying that both parties would test do a battle of might in 2015. The president, during the meeting, further stated that, despite political moves by some people in the state to discourage the people from attending the rally, they still turned out en masse to participate in the PDP rally.

“In 2015, we will know who owns Kwara. And if God gives us the opportunity, which I believe, probably we will even test our strength before 2015. All stolen mandates will return to PDP. So, let us continue to encourage you and we will continue to work together with your leaders, supporters and make sure that not only will we win the election at the national level, we will also win at the state level.

“We must take over the state structures of the party, the governor and the state Assembly. We must take all, because it is easier to reach the grass roots through the states than the centre because the country is so big that by the time we distribute positions, you will not be noticed. But at the state level, we can touch more people. So, any state we are unable to win, members of the party in that state will continue to live like orphans. So, definitely, we are taking Kwara. So, I am quite pleased with what you have done today,” Jonathan said.

However, in a swift reaction to the statement by the President, the APC issued a statement titled, “Forget Kwara Come 2015 and Face Governance.” The statement, signed by the APC Interim Publicity Secretary in the state, Alhaji Sulyman Buhari, said the perpetual claims on the political future of Kwara State by President  Jonathan should be brushed-off by Nigerians.

“The frustration of the PDP and its leaders is understandable, after the desertion of the party by the people of Kwara.

But the style of mis-informing Nigerians by Mr President is condemnable. President Jonathan has forgotten some basic facts of history that PDP has been in existence since 1999, at the federal level but there was no PDP in Kwara until 2003, when the Sarakis adopted the party.

“Kwarans supported and joined en masse, the PDP due to the love for the Sarakis. Mr President is being deceived, even his supporters in Kwara are known to be saying it around town that they know President Jonathan can’t win election in Kwara.

“Meanwhile, there is no stolen mandate in Kwara. The mandate was given to Governor Abdulfatah Ahmed administration by Kwarans, who built and renovated additional five general hospitals recently. The Community Health Insurance Scheme to boost healthcare delivery in the state has been expanded to cover 600,000 Kwarans; stories of 5,400 youths have changed from unemployment to empowerment through the first phase of the Quick Win programme the APC-led state government started few days ago and many more. Any person that tagged a representing mandate like the mandate given to Governor Ahmed a stolen mandate is either being mischievous or too inept to understand the mandate.

“It is childish for PDP to think Kwarans will trade the peace and sustainable development presently enjoyed in the state for bad leadership, corrupt practices and mismanagement, which is the hallmark of PDP. Mr President is still in the euphoria of the paid non-Kwarans he addressed in Ilorin but it remains a mirage how a party without leadership and structure, with no councillor in any of the 193 wards, with no chairman in any of the 16 Local governments and just two members out of 24 members in the House of Assembly, will win any election in Kwara State.

“However, these nocturnal politicians in the PDP can continue to deceive Mr. President with their paper-weight in the state to bargain for money or positions, that is PDP’s headache. But we state that the election-winning machinery as presently formulated in the APC today is capable of winning all elections in Kwara State if elections are held today,” the statement said.
